How to Create a Finance Blog for Your Freelance Brand

Creating a finance blog is a powerful way for freelancers to establish authority, attract clients, and showcase expertise in financial management. A finance blog serves as both a marketing tool and a knowledge-sharing platform. Freelancers who manage finances for clients or their own business can benefit from blogging by demonstrating thought leadership, building credibility, and improving online visibility.

In this article, we explore the step-by-step process to create a finance blog for a freelance brand, covering planning, content creation, SEO, promotion, and monetization strategies.

Why Freelancers Should Start a Finance Blog

A finance blog can benefit freelancers in multiple ways:

Establish Expertise: Sharing insights about budgeting, accounting, taxes, and financial strategies positions the freelancer as an authority in finance.

Attract Clients: A blog highlights skills and builds trust, making potential clients more likely to hire the freelancer.

Generate Leads: Well-optimized content can rank in search engines, attracting organic traffic and inquiries.

Networking Opportunities: Other freelancers, financial professionals, and industry stakeholders may engage with your blog, creating collaboration opportunities.

Passive Income Potential: Blogs can be monetized through sponsored content, affiliate links, or selling digital products.

Starting a finance blog is not just about writing; it is about building a personal brand that communicates expertise, professionalism, and reliability.

Step One: Define Your Blog Goals

Before creating a finance blog, clarify your objectives:

Do you want to attract new freelance clients?

Are you aiming to educate small business owners about finance?

Will your blog serve as a platform for passive income through ads or affiliate programs?

Defining clear goals guides your content strategy, tone, and monetization approach.

Step Two: Choose a Niche

Finance is a broad field. Choosing a niche helps attract a specific audience and stand out in a crowded market. Popular finance blog niches for freelancers include:

Freelance accounting tips

Tax planning for freelancers and small businesses

Budgeting strategies for self-employed professionals

Cryptocurrency and digital finance

Financial software and tools for freelancers

Focusing on a niche ensures consistent content creation and helps establish authority in a targeted area.

Step Three: Select a Domain and Hosting

Choose a domain name that reflects your freelance brand and finance focus. Consider:

Using your name or brand name

Including keywords like finance, accounting, or freelance finance

Keeping it short, memorable, and easy to spell

Select a reliable hosting provider to ensure fast loading times, security, and minimal downtime. Providers such as Bluehost, SiteGround, or Hostinger offer plans suitable for beginners and freelancers.

Step Five: Plan Your Content Strategy

Effective content planning ensures regular posting and audience engagement. Steps to plan content:

Keyword Research: Identify finance-related keywords that your target audience searches for. Tools like Google Keyword Planner, Ubersuggest, or SEMrush can help.

Content Calendar: Schedule blog posts weekly or monthly, ensuring a mix of tutorials, case studies, guides, and opinion pieces.

Content Types:

How-to guides for financial management

Client success stories and case studies

Reviews of finance tools and software

Industry news and trends in freelance finance

Consistent, high-quality content attracts visitors and boosts SEO performance.

Step Seven: Optimize for SEO

SEO is crucial to attract organic traffic to your finance blog. Key optimization strategies:

On-Page SEO:

Use keywords in titles, meta descriptions, and headings

Include internal and external links

Optimize images with alt text and descriptive filenames

Technical SEO:

Ensure fast loading speeds

Use SSL certificates for secure browsing

Maintain mobile responsiveness

Content SEO:

Write comprehensive posts over 1000 words

Address specific questions and provide actionable solutions

Update older posts regularly to maintain relevance

SEO optimization increases visibility in search engines and attracts targeted readers interested in finance for freelancers.

Step Nine: Monetize Your Blog

Once your blog gains traffic and credibility, consider monetization:

Affiliate Marketing: Recommend finance tools, software, or services relevant to your audience.

Sponsored Content: Collaborate with financial companies to create sponsored posts.

Digital Products: Sell templates, e-books, or courses on budgeting, accounting, or financial planning.

Consulting Services: Offer freelance financial consulting directly through your blog.

Monetization enhances the profitability of your freelance brand while providing value to your readers.

Step Ten: Monitor and Improve

Regularly track blog performance using analytics tools:

Google Analytics for traffic, user behavior, and engagement

Search Console for indexing and SEO insights

Social media analytics for promotion performance

Use data to refine content strategy, identify popular topics, and improve user experience.
